Manager of Network Pharmacy Claims and Accounts Receivable

The Manager of Network Pharmacy Claims and Accounts Receivable oversees the daily operations of the Healthcare Revenue Cycle team to ensure appropriate and maximum cash collected.

What You’ll Do

  • Oversee a team that provides direct support to pharmacy operations by ensuring all prescriptions are adjudicated through third party payors prior to dispensing
  • Pre-adjudicate prescriptions through the pharmacy’s pharmacy management system(s) utilizing NCPDP standard transaction sets
  • Respond and resolve pre-adjudication rejections including developing processes and procedures to ensure assurance of payment for all prescriptions dispensed along with coordinating with the clinical team to maintain a clinically acceptable level of continuity of care
  • Support processes to ensure that prescribers and patients are notified and flagged for any prescriptions that require prior authorization
  • Coordinate patient receivables processing end to end including invoicing, receiving patient payments, and monitoring of aging receivables
  • Partner with the payment reconciliation team to ensure that third party payments are correctly posted to transactions
  • Participate in strategic initiatives to provide scalable support to LTC and retail business growth among multiple pharmacy sites
  • Utilize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) to Identify and develop continuous process initiatives to improve cash collection payments and velocity
  • Provide effective leadership to members of their direct reports including training, coaching, and career development initiatives
